Surprise Saturday - Lesney Matchbox Garage

Time again for something different. Today we examine another accessory item. This is Lesney Matchbox A3a, the Accessory Pack Garage. It is exactly as it claims, a cast metal residential style garage. The quality is what one would expect from a Lesney product of this era:

This cast metal building was introduced in 1958, and remained in production until 1964. This is an unusual accessory in the diecast car world, but one that has a lot of play value. The entirety of the piece is metal, including the opening doors:

Based on box type, this example was likely made between 1958-60, appropriate for the castings pictured above. The garage also came with a metal clip that was used to link garages together - mine, as many today, is missing this. Definitely a cool piece that I am glad to have.
